5-Amino-3-(dimethylamino)-3H-1,2,3-oxadiazol-1-ium chloride
TL;DR: 5-Amino-3-(dimethylamino)-3H-1,2,3-oxadiazol-1-ium chloride (CAS 16142-33-9) is a chemical compound with molecular formula C4H9ClN4O and molecular weight 164.05 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
3-N,3-N-dimethyloxadiazol-3-ium-3,5-diamine chloride
Also Known As: 3-(Dimethylamino)sydnone imine hydrochloride, 3-Dimethylaminosydnonimine hydrochloride, Sydnone imine, 3-(dimethylamino)-, monohydrochloride, 3-N,3-N-dimethyloxadiazol-3-ium-3,5-diamine chloride, 5-Amino-3-(dimethylamino)-3H-1,2,3-oxadiazol-1-ium chloride
| Molecular Formula | C4H9ClN4O |
|---|---|
| Molecular Weight | 164.05 g/mol |
| LogP | -4.2541 |
| Topological Polar Surface Area | 59.2 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 5 |
| Rotatable Bonds | 1 |
| Exact Mass | 164.0465 |
| Heavy Atoms | 10 |
| Complexity | 96.0 |
Chemical Identifiers
| CAS Number | 16142-33-9 |
|---|---|
| SMILES | CN(C)[N+]1=NOC(=C1)N.[Cl-] |
| InChIKey | HUGANTMXIYFMCP-UHFFFAOYSA-M |
